Cultural Education and Motivations – You Yangs Regional Park
In Term 1 the year 11 OES class went to the You Yangs Regional Park to take a first-hand look and the environments and what makes up the unique environments of this area. During the trip students took park in an Cultural Education talk from one of the Parks Victoria Rangers and a proud Wadawurrung women. She talked to the students about the perceptions and interactions of her people before and after European Settlement and how the European Settlement changed the connection to Country for her people. They also needed to look at the different types of Motivations people could/would have to visit the You Yang’s Regional Park, in this case students were there to gather information and learn about the area, were others may be going to the area to Bushwalk, have a Picnic, Bird watch or partake in other Recreation Activities.
Overall students went well in discovering new things about the outdoor environment, what motivates them to go into the outdoors and the responses they may have whilst there. But also looking into the deep history of the areas and the Wadawurrung people who have lived there for thousands of years.
